Yesterdays match was won with 40lb peg53 odd 2nd 36lb peg 19 , 3rd 29lb peg44. Most back ups were 25lb down to 12lb..over 35 fished. Conditions were wind and rain . Winning method was feeder to island . Stamp of fish is generally @6-8oz the 2lbers dont make a big appearance.

The 100lb+ bag that won recently came from corner peg near cafe, the wind was blowing into it and had been for quite a while, the fish were concentrated there and the angler that drew it was good enough to plunder it.

Don't expect big weights all round expect to be busy for at least 1 hour of the match...make the choice go for any fish or wait for a bite from a bigger fish. Any bait will get a bite the challenge you will have is can you hit the bite and work out what's happening down below.....
